Gaining Insights into Certificate Attestation for Documents in Dubai
Certificate attestation is a necessary process for authenticating documents required for use in Dubai. It ensures the legitimacy of your documents by attesting their issuance and truthfulness.
Several government agencies in Dubai oversee the attestation process. This generally involves stages like verification by the issuing authority, consulate of your home country, and eventually the UAE agency.
Acquiring knowledge of these requirements is important to ensure a smooth attestation process.

Embarking On the Dubai Government Attestation Process for Certificates and Documents
To facilitate the acceptance of educational certificates and documents in Dubai, a rigorous attestation process is mandatory. This process involves of confirming the origin of documents through authorized authorities.
First, documents must be attested by the issuing authority. Subsequently, they demand attestation from the UAE Ministry of Foreign Affairs. The final stage includes attestation by the Dubai Department of Economic Development. This multi-tiered system affirms the genuineness of documents for legal purposes within the UAE.
